> Description
> -------
>
> I was experiencing crashes when updating iCal resources, similar to bug 273676 (but \
> probably not the same) and after some debugging I found out that the Q_ASSERT to \
> check that m_collection indeed has the key to remove (line 1030) was causing the \
> issue. Adding a check to be sure the key is indeed in m_collections should fix \
> that, but I'm not sure if code should worry more about why the key is not in \
> m_collections or just do the check. Makes sense?
>
> This addresses bug 273676.

> Testing
> -------
>
> 1. Add an iCal resource (I'm actually not sure if this happens with all iCal \
> resources, if needed I could point at one URL which fails in all of my KDE 4.7 \
> installations) 2. Plasma crashes
> 3. Apply the patch and restart plasma-desktop
> 4. Open KOrganizer and update the iCal resource, plasma should not crash now
